As pointed out in the comments…

The San Antonio ISD has a Digital Citizenship Website (http://saisdcybersafety.pbworks.com/) which showcases the student-created video as well as outlines the curriculum, expectations, lessons, activities, and resources for parents, teachers and students.

Disclosure: This is my school district and the work on the web site above was primarily the work of Stephanie Correa (scorrea2@saisd.net) in the Instructional Technology Services Office. Great job, SAISD!!
